Top 3 Ways to Use FRIP for an Authentic Trip
1. Outdoor & Adventure (Action-Packed Korea)
- Night Hiking (야간 등산): Climb mountains like Inwangsan or Achasan with a local crew to witness breathtaking, panoramic views of Seoul lit up at night.
- Seasonal Sports: Book a day-trip surf lesson at Yangyang (Korea's surfing mecca) or a snowboarding crew setup for the winter.
| Image source: Korea Digital Gu |
2. K-Culture One-Day Classes (Unique Souvenirs)
- Traditional Crafts: Learn to make your own Mother-of-Pearl (Najeonchilgi) smart-toks, mix your own K-beauty perfume, or craft custom Korean stamp seals (Dojang).
- Cooking Classes: Learn how to make authentic Kimchi or local home-cooked meals from a local chef in a residential neighborhood.

Global Platform vs. FRIP Service Comparison
| Feature | Global OTAs (Klook, Viator) | Local Platform (FRIP) |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Audience | International tourists | South Korean local residents |
| Pricing Level | Higher (includes tourist markup) | Baseline domestic market rates |
| Activity Style | Large-scale tours, landmark tickets | Small-group workshops, local sports clubs |
| Language Profile | Full English support and guides | Korean interface, multilingual hosts |
| Local Interaction | Very low (interact with other tourists) | Extremely high (surrounded by locals) |
Step-by-Step Guide: Foreign User Registration and Booking
Step 1: Application Download and Language Onboarding
- Download the App: "FRIP" or "Friendtrip" in the Apple App Store or Google Play Store
- Launch the application: The system supports international app store regions and adjusts its baseline interface to accommodate English users.
- Keep a mobile translation tool or a screen-capture translator like Papago active in the background to help you easily read through specific host descriptions.
Step 2: Create an Account Without a Korean ID
- Navigate to the login screen and select a social media integration option: Google or KakaoTalk. Using a KakaoTalk account is highly recommended, as it simplifies direct chat notifications later.
- Complete your user profile by entering your full legal name as it appears on your passport and a valid email address.
- Skip the optional phone number verification field during this stage. Your account is now fully operational for browsing and booking.
Step 3: Filtering for Ideal Local Activities
- Use the search bar or category filters located at the top of the home screen.
- Apply the Location Filter to match your itinerary, targeting specific hubs such as Seoul (Gangnam, Hongdae, Seongsu), Busan (Haeundae), or Jeju Island.
- Check the schedule constraints of your selected listing. Weekday evening sessions (starting after 19:00) and weekend daytime slots feature the highest local attendance rates.
- Look for international-friendly markers. While the app interface is accessible, check the activity description for phrases like "English available," "Foreigners welcome," or translation indicators within the host's profile bio.
Step 4: Complete the Booking Using International Payments
- Tap the Book Now or Apply button at the base of the activity page. Select your preferred date, session time, and participant count.
- Input your basic attendee information. If you do not possess a active local mobile number, input the contact number of your current accommodation or use a placeholder format alongside your verified email address.
- Navigate to the final payment options segment. Do not select the standard domestic credit card option, which triggers local 3D-Secure authentication protocols requiring a Korean phone.
- Choose the International Credit Card option (supporting Visa, Mastercard, or JCB). Alternatively, utilize local digital tourist cards like WOWPASS or Trip.PASS by selecting their respective payment paths, or route the transaction through Kakao Pay using a pre-linked international card.
- Confirm the transaction. Once approved, your reservation confirmation voucher will generate instantly under the My Page section, accompanied by an automated confirmation notification.
Technical Mobile Tips for a Smooth Experience
Use Real-Time Screen Translation :
If you are using an iOS device, take a quick screenshot of the page and run it through the Papago app's system-wide widget. This lets you read full item checklists, meeting details, and safety instructions in English in just a few seconds.
Pin Your Meeting Locations on Naver Map:
Always look for the specific address string inside your booking details, copy it, and paste it directly into Naver Map. This ensures you get the exact subway exits, walking routes, and live bus arrival times so you can make it to your meetup on time.
